Output d92d0e35731ee1e7f59bc59d9d25cdc8a08f6aaae56d76242a63586b72898bb3:28

value
189186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c12f8fc3b67eae3ed24b8a98dd51fe0837a6d51 OP_EQUAL
address
3ETfFe2oiMsoz7KqkVSMACqD8cVwBenbrm
transaction
d92d0e35731ee1e7f59bc59d9d25cdc8a08f6aaae56d76242a63586b72898bb3